推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文详细介绍了在openSUSE Linux操作系统上安装与使用IntelliJ IDEA的步骤。从安装Java环境开始,逐步讲解了如何下载安装包、配置环境变量,以及启动和配置IntelliJ IDEA,助力开发者高效开发。
本文目录导读:
在当今软件开发领域,IntelliJ IDEA 凭借其强大的功能、智能的代码提示和出色的性能,已经成为众多开发者的首选集成开发环境(IDE),本文将详细介绍如何在 openSUSE 系统下安装并使用 IntelliJ IDEA,帮助开发者充分利用这一优秀的工具。
安装 IntelliJ IDEA
1、下载 IntelliJ IDEA
访问 IntelliJ IDEA 的官方网站(https://www.jetbrains.com/idea/),选择适合 openSUSE 系统的版本进行下载,IntelliJ IDEA 提供了两个版本:Ultimate 和 Community,Ultimate 版本功能更全面,但需要付费;Community 版本免费,但功能相对较少。
2、安装 IntelliJ IDEA
下载完成后,解压缩安装包,进入解压缩后的文件夹,在终端中,切换到该文件夹,执行以下命令:
./idea.sh
运行此命令后,将启动 IntelliJ IDEA 的安装向导,按照向导提示,选择安装路径、设置 JVM 参数等,直至完成安装。
配置 IntelliJ IDEA
1、设置字体和主题
打开 IntelliJ IDEA,在菜单栏中依次选择“File” -> “Settings”(Windows 系统下为“Options”),在弹出的设置窗口中,选择“Appearance” -> “Override default fonts by”选项,设置合适的字体和大小。
还可以在“Appearance”选项卡中设置主题,使 IDE 界面更符合个人喜好。
2、安装插件
IntelliJ IDEA 支持丰富的插件,可以帮助开发者提高工作效率,在设置窗口中,选择“Plugins”选项卡,可以浏览和安装各种插件,安装中文语言包插件可以让 IntelliJ IDEA 的界面显示中文。
3、配置代码风格
在设置窗口中,选择“Editor” -> “Code Style”,可以配置代码格式、缩进、换行等,通过统一代码风格,可以提高团队协作效率。
使用 IntelliJ IDEA
1、创建项目
在 IntelliJ IDEA 中,可以创建多种类型的项目,创建一个 Java 项目,只需在欢迎界面中选择“Create New Project”,然后选择 Java,接着选择合适的 SDK,最后填写项目名称和路径即可。
2、编写代码
在项目创建后,可以开始编写代码,IntelliJ IDEA 提供了智能的代码提示、自动补全、语法高亮等功能,可以帮助开发者快速编写代码。
3、调试代码
IntelliJ IDEA 内置了强大的调试功能,在代码中设置断点,然后点击“Debug”按钮,即可进入调试模式,在调试过程中,可以查看变量值、跟踪执行流程等。
4、运行项目
在项目创建后,可以点击“Run”按钮运行项目,IntelliJ IDEA 会自动编译项目,并在内置的浏览器中打开运行结果。
在 openSUSE 系统下安装和使用 IntelliJ IDEA,可以让开发者充分利用这一优秀的 IDE,提高开发效率,通过本文的介绍,相信你已经掌握了在 openSUSE 系统下安装和配置 IntelliJ IDEA 的方法,尽情享受编程的乐趣吧!
相关关键词:
openSUSE, IntelliJ IDEA, 安装, 配置, 使用, 下载, SDK, 插件, 代码风格, 项目, 编写代码, 调试, 运行, 主题, 字体, 智能提示, 自动补全, 语法高亮, 调试功能, 运行结果, 开发效率, 编程乐趣, 安装向导, JVM 参数, 设置窗口, 代码提示, 代码补全, 代码调试, 跨平台, 开发工具, 集成开发环境, Java, 编程环境, 软件开发, 项目管理, 代码优化, 调试技巧, 运行配置, 性能优化, 插件市场, 开源软件, 开发社区, 技术支持, 使用心得, 学习资源, 开发经验, 软件工程师, 程序员, 编程语言, 计算机科学, 软件工程, 软件架构, 软件设计, 软件测试, 软件维护, 软件部署, 软件开发流程, 软件开发工具